1919 Marriage Leo Korda-2 to Emma Schacke-2


Stevens Point Daily Journal
April 29, 1919

A very pretty wedding, and one of much interest locally, was that of Leo F. Korda-2, son of Mr. and Mrs. Anton Korda-3, 661 Prentice street, this city, and Miss Emma Schacke-2 of Chicago. The ceremony took place at St. Philomen's Catholic church in Chicago on Saturday morning, April 26, at 9 o'clock, Rev. Father Laukemper officiating. A solo, "Ave Maria," was sung by George Strauk, an eleven-year-old Indian boy from Oklahoma.

The bride wore a beautiful dress of ivory satin embroidered in silver, with a court train of silver lace. She also wore a veil, of liberty style, and carried a shower bouquet of roses and lilies of the valley. Miss Martha Schacke-2, a sister of the bride, was bridesmaid and wore a dress of light green satin and a hat of light maline of the same shade. She carried a bouquet of roses. Miss Pauline Mootz, a close friend of the bride, also served as bridesmaid and wore a gown of pale blue satin and a maline hat to match. Her bouquet was also of roses.

Emil Sievert, a navy chum of the groom, was the best man, and Paul Schacke-2, brother of the bride, was usher.

Dinner was served to about forty guests, the tables being prettily decorated with ferns and roses.

Mr. and Mrs. Korda have already furnished their flat at 1938 North Ridgeway avenue, Chicago, and are already at home there. Mr. Korda, who was recently discharged from the naval service, is employed in that city.

1920 US Census, Leo Korda-2 Family


US Census
2 Jan 1920

Chicago, Cook County
1938 Ridgeway Ave.
Renting.

Leo Korda-2, Head. Head. Male, White, 26 years, married. Can read and write. Born in Wisconsin, Parents born in Germany. Carpenter in Box Factory.

Emma Korda [Emma Schacke-2] , Wife. Female, White, 23 years, married. Can read and write. Born in Illinois, Parents borth in Germany.



Database online. Year: 1920; Census Place: Chicago Ward 35, Cook (Chicago), Illinois; Roll: T625_355; Page: 1A; Enumeration District: 2219; Image: 975.

Leo and Paul Korda visiting Stevens Point Aug 1921


The Gazette
Stevens Point
24 August 1921


Leo F. Korda-2, who came here from Chicago last week to visit his parents, returned south on Sunday afternoon's train. He was accompanied to this city by Mrs. Korda [Emma Schacke-2], who will remain several days longer. Paul Korda-2 of Chicago also spent last week at the family home on Prentice St.

1930 Census, Leo Korda-2 family


US Census
12 Apr 1930
Chicago, Ward 39
Cook County, Illinois


4845 Parker
Home Owned, Value $7,000
Radio in home

Leo F. Korda-2, Head. Male, White, 36 years, married, age at first marriage 26 years, not attending school, can read and write. Born in Wisconsin. Parents born in Germany. Carpenter in building construction.

Emma B. Korda [Emma B. Schacke-2], wife. Female, White, 34 years, married, age at first marriage 24 years, not attending school, can read and write. Born in Illinois. Parents born in Germany.

Virginia Korda-1, daughter. Female, White, 6 years, attending school. Born in Illinois. Father born in Wisconsin, Mother born in Illinois.

Database online. Year: 1930; Census Place: Chicago, Cook, Illinois; Roll: 476; Page: 12A; Enumeration District
